WebJul 18, 2024 · How to Water Orchids – Key Takeaways: Most orchid plants will need to be watered every 5 to 10 days during the spring, summer, and early fall months when the soil base is 90%+ dry. During winter, when the orchid plant enters a period of dormancy, watering cycles should be reduced to every 10 to 15 days or when the moisture content present in ...

WebDec 11, 2024 · A handy formula for a soilless potting mix, ideal for your Christmas cactus is: 1 part cactus and succulent mix. 1 part orchid mix. 1 part horticultural pumice, sand, or fine gravel. Thoroughly combine and fill a container with adequate drainage holes. This blend is texturally-rich, so it’s airy and lightweight.

WebFeb 16, 2024 · Here’s how: First, preheat your oven to 180°F. Second, add a bit of water to the soil mix and spread it evenly on a roasting tray. After that, cover the mix with aluminum foil and leave it in the oven for around 45–60 minutes. Take the tray out of the oven and remove the foil cover.
